Subject: Key rotation — stale-cache postmortem follow-up

Team,

Postmortem for the Glimmerfeed stale-cache bug is done. Root cause: cache invalidation tokens were reused after the Varnwick proxy restart, serving 40-minute-old entries. Fix shipped Tuesday. As part of remediation we're rotating credentials for the cache-purge service, effective immediately. Old keys die Friday. Update your local configs before then or purge calls will 403. Details in the postmortem doc linked from the sync agenda. The new key for the purge endpoint is below.

gateway credential: kto23_LX9A4ys6i4nzHtpOLNLodKK

## Authentication

Plugins hooking into the Keyrelay reset flow must authenticate against the flow API. No session cookies. No API keys in query strings. Bearer tokens only, scoped to `reset:hooks`. Tokens expire after 12 hours; refresh via the Keyrelay developer portal. Rate limit: 60 calls per minute per plugin. Exceeding it suspends the plugin for one hour. Test against the sandbox tenant before touching production resets. Use the sandbox token below.

session JWT of yawep-yawep = eyJhbGciOiJIUzI1NiIsInR5cCI6IkpXVCJ9.eyJzdWIiOiI3pWF3_In0.aXYsHiog

Hi Renna,

Handing over the Fableweave template rendering issue. Render times on the promo templates spiked to 900ms after Tuesday's partial-cache change; I rolled the cache TTL back to 15 minutes, which stabilized things, but the root cause (nested include resolution) is still open. Watch the p95 dashboard hourly, and don't re-enable the partial cache without load-testing first. If anything regresses overnight, reach the templating crew here.

billing contact of tahaf-kafop = istwyn_fraox@norvaworks.corp